Hand #70-72: Danchev Gets His Fill

Nível 4 : 6,000/12,000, 2,000 ante
Dimitar Danchev
Dimitar Danchev

Hand #70: Jon Lane folded his button, Alex Bolotin raised to 31,000 out of the small blind, and Dimitar Danchev called. The flop came {2-Hearts}{3-Spades}{4-Spades}, Bolotin tossed out a bet of around 40,000, and Danchev called.

The turn was the {5-Spades}, Bolotin checked, and Danchev took the pot down with a bet.

Hand #71: Bolotin folded his button, Danchev raised to 30,000 from the small blind, and Lane called. The flop came {k-Spades}{9-Clubs}{5-Diamonds}, and Danchev check-folded to a bet of 40,000.

Hand #72: Danchev raised to 24,000 on the button, Lane called out of the small blind, and the flop came {q-Hearts}{2-Diamonds}{2-Spades}. Lane checked, Danchev tossed out 21,000, and Lane quickly check-raised to 45,000. Danchev called.

The turn was the {4-Spades}, Lane led out for 40,000, Danchev called, and the {a-Hearts} completed the board. Lane casually flipped out 55,000, and Danchev slid out a raise to 222,000. Lane called, then mucked when Danchev showed {q-Clubs}{q-Diamonds} for a full house.

Hands #73-76: Lane Picking Up Steam

Nível 4 : 6,000/12,000, 2,000 ante

Hand #73: Jon Lane opened to 31,000 and won the blinds and antes.

Hand #74: Dimitar Danchev raised to 30,000 from the small blind before Jon Lane raised to 82,000. Danchev mucked and Lane was pushed the pot.

Hand #75: Dimitar Danchev opened to 24,000 and both Jon Lane and Alex Bolotin called to see a {8-Clubs}{4-Spades}{Q-Spades} flop fall with the action checked round.

The turn landed the {J-Hearts} and Lane led out for 67,000 which was enough to produce to swift folds from his opponent.

Hand #76: Jon Lane raised to 31,000 and collected the blinds and antes.

Hand #77-82: One Showdown

Nível 5 : 8,000/16,000, 2,000 ante

Hand #77: Alex Bolotin raised to 32,000 on the button, winning the blinds and antes.

Hand #78: Jon Lane and Bolotin took a flop of [9h8scqd]. Lane led out for 20,000, Bolotin called, and the turn was the {3-Spades}. Lane checked, Bolotin checked behind, and the river was the {7-Diamonds}. Both players checked, Lane showed {6-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}, but it was no good against Bolotin's {10-Clubs}{8-Hearts}.

Hand #79: Lane raised to 38,000 on the button, Danchev three-bet to 106,000 from the big blind, and Lane folded.

Hand #80: Bolotin raised to 32,000 on the button, winning the blinds and antes.

Hand #81: Lane completed from the small blind, Bolotin checked, and the flop was {q-Spades}{k-Spades}{3-Diamonds}. Lane checked, Bolotin fired out 20,000, and Lane folded.

Hand #82: Lane had the button and took the blinds and antes with a raise to 35,000.

Hands #83-88: Slow Goings

Nível 5 : 8,000/16,000, 2,000 ante

Hand #83: Alex Bolotin raised to 32,000 and won the blinds and antes.

Hand #84: Jon Lane raised to 41,000 from the small blind and Alex Bolotin made the call to see a {10-Clubs}{10-Hearts}{K-Clubs} flop fall. Lane fired out 53,000 and Bolotin quickly mucked.

Hand #85: Dimitar Danchev received a walk in the big blind.

Hand #86: Alex Bolotin opened to 32,000 and won the blinds and antes.

Hand #87: Dimitar Danchev raised to 32,000 and won the blinds and antes.

Hand #88: Jon Lane opened to 35,000 and Dimitar Danchev three-bet to 106,000 from the big blind. Lane made the call and after the dealer spread a {10-Hearts}{10-Spades}{Q-Diamonds} flop, Danchev and Lane both checked.

The turn fell the {8-Clubs} and Danchev checked before Lane bet out 100,000. Danchev made the call as the {7-Spades} completed the board on the river and both players checked. Danchev tabled his {A-}{K-}, but it would be Lane's {9-}{8-} that would see him scoop the pot.

Hand #89-93: Back-to-Back Showdowns

Nível 5 : 8,000/16,000, 2,000 ante

Hand #89: Alex Bolotin was on the button and raised to 32,000. Jon Lane called from the big blind, and the flop fell {9-Clubs}{6-Diamonds}{7-Diamonds}. The two players checked. The turn was the {q-Diamonds}, Lane led out for 34,000, and Bolotin called. The {5-Diamonds} completed the board, the two players checked, and Lane showed {a-Clubs}{6-Hearts}. Bolotin revealed {q-}{4-}, for a superior pair, and was awarded the pot.

Hand #90: Dimitar Danchev raised to 32,000 on the button, Lane called out of the small blind, and the pair took a flop of {a-Diamonds}{9-Diamonds}{k-Clubs}. Both players checked, the turn was the {q-Spades}, and Lane led out for 40,000. Danchev called.

The river was the {6-Spades}, both players checked, and Lane showed {2-Hearts}{2-Diamonds} for a pair of deuces. The Bulgarian revealed {k-Diamonds}{3-Hearts} for a pair of kings, and pulled in the pot.

Hand #91: Lane raised to 35,000 on the button, and both of his opponents folded.

Hand #92: Bolotin won the pot with a raise to 32,000 on the button,

Hand #93: Danchev raised to 32,000 on the button, winning the blinds and antes.

Hands #94-97: Bolotin Takes One from Danchev

Nível 5 : 8,000/16,000, 2,000 ante

Hand #94: Jon Lane raised to 35,000 and Dimitar Danchev made the call to see a {5-Hearts}{7-Diamonds}{10-Clubs} flop fall. Danchev check-folded to Lane's 40,000-chip continuation bet.

Hand #95: Dimitar Danchev raised to 40,000 from the small blind and Jon Lane called from the big to see a {6-Spades}{9-Diamonds}{4-Spades} flop fall with both players checking.

The turn of the {8-Diamonds} was checked through before the {8-Hearts} completed the board on the river. Both players again checked with Danchev tabling his {A-Spades}{10-Spades} to win the pot.

Hand #96: Dimitar Danchev opened to 32,000 and won the blinds and antes.

Hand #97: Alex Bolotin raised to 42,000 from the small blind and Dimitar Danchev defended his big to see a {10-Spades}{9-Spades}{9-Diamonds} and Bolotin bet out 50,000 with Danchev calling as the {J-Clubs} landed on the turn.

Bolotin tossed in 125,000 and Danchev made the call as the {K-Spades} fell on the river. Bolotin cut out a bet of 300,000 and Danchev quickly folded.
